Subject: [patch 04/14] smc: convert to net_device_ops

Convert both eisa and mca versions of this driver, though I doubt
anyone still has the hardware.
Signed-off-by: Stephen Hemminger <shemminger@vyatta.com>
--- a/drivers/net/smc-mca.c 2008-11-25 16:23:38.000000000 -0800
+++ b/drivers/net/smc-mca.c 2008-11-25 16:41:33.000000000 -0800
@@ -182,6 +182,22 @@ static char *smc_mca_adapter_names[] __i
static int ultra_found = 0;
+
+static const struct net_device_ops ultra_netdev_ops = {
+ .ndo_open = ultramca_open,
+ .ndo_stop = ultramca_close_card,
+
+ .ndo_start_xmit = ei_start_xmit,
+ .ndo_tx_timeout = ei_tx_timeout,
+ .ndo_get_stats = ei_get_stats,
+ .ndo_set_multicast_list = ei_set_multicast_list,
+ .ndo_validate_addr = eth_validate_addr,
+ .ndo_change_mtu = eth_change_mtu,
+#ifdef CONFIG_NET_POLL_CONTROLLER
+ .ndo_poll_controller = ei_poll,
+#endif
+};
+
static int __init ultramca_probe(struct device *gen_dev)
{
unsigned short ioaddr;
@@ -384,11 +400,7 @@ static int __init ultramca_probe(struct
ei_status.priv = slot;
- dev->open = &ultramca_open;
- dev->stop = &ultramca_close_card;
-#ifdef CONFIG_NET_POLL_CONTROLLER
- dev->poll_controller = ei_poll;
-#endif
+ dev->netdev_ops = &ultramca_netdev_ops;
NS8390_init(dev, 0);
--- a/drivers/net/smc-ultra.c 2008-11-25 16:23:38.000000000 -0800
+++ b/drivers/net/smc-ultra.c 2008-11-25 16:41:33.000000000 -0800
@@ -187,6 +187,21 @@ out:
}
#endif
+static const struct net_device_ops ultra_netdev_ops = {
+ .ndo_open = ultra_open,
+ .ndo_stop = ultra_close_card,
+
+ .ndo_start_xmit = ei_start_xmit,
+ .ndo_tx_timeout = ei_tx_timeout,
+ .ndo_get_stats = ei_get_stats,
+ .ndo_set_multicast_list = ei_set_multicast_list,
+ .ndo_validate_addr = eth_validate_addr,
+ .ndo_change_mtu = eth_change_mtu,
+#ifdef CONFIG_NET_POLL_CONTROLLER
+ .ndo_poll_controller = ei_poll,
+#endif
+};
+
static int __init ultra_probe1(struct net_device *dev, int ioaddr)
{
int i, retval;
@@ -300,11 +315,8 @@ static int __init ultra_probe1(struct ne
ei_status.get_8390_hdr = &ultra_get_8390_hdr;
}
ei_status.reset_8390 = &ultra_reset_8390;
- dev->open = &ultra_open;
- dev->stop = &ultra_close_card;
-#ifdef CONFIG_NET_POLL_CONTROLLER
- dev->poll_controller = ei_poll;
-#endif
+
+ dev->netdev_ops = &ultra_netdev_ops;
NS8390_init(dev, 0);
retval = register_netdev(dev);
